Spiderweb cracks or black ink-blot patches spreading from an impact point.
Vertical or horizontal lines, flickering, or shimmering that comes and goes.
The laptop is clearly on — you can hear it — but the display stays dark or is barely visible.
Patches of the screen that stay white, dark, or off-color no matter what's displayed.
If plugging into a TV or monitor looks fine, the laptop's panel (not the computer) is the problem — good news, that's fixable.
Broken hinges and cracked frames often travel with screen damage and can be handled in the same repair.
Laptop screens aren't one-size-fits-all — resolution, brightness, touch or non-touch, and connector type all vary by model. Step one is identifying the exact panel your machine takes, which I confirm from the model and serial before ordering anything.
Once the panel arrives, the replacement itself typically happens in a single in-home visit, and most screen repairs are wrapped up within about 24 hours of having the part in hand.
If the damage turns out to be more than the panel — a bent chassis or a damaged display cable — you'll get the full picture and an honest recommendation on whether the repair still makes sense for your machine's age and value.

For most otherwise-healthy laptops, a screen replacement costs far less than replacement. If your machine is old enough that I wouldn't put the money in, I'll tell you.
Usually about 24 hours once the correct panel is in hand. Panels are ordered per-model, so total time depends on parts availability for your specific machine.
Yes — MacBook screen work is common. Some late-model Apple displays are costly enough that we'll talk through whether it's worth it first.
Usually yes if it's just glass, but spreading cracks and pressure marks tend to get worse. Plugging into an external monitor is a safe stopgap until the panel arrives.
